I think my site was hacked
Signs of a hack include unexpected pop-ups or ads, spam pages you didn't create, redirects to strange sites, a browser "deceptive site" warning, or emails from your domain you didn't send. Act quickly to limit the damage.

- Change every password: control panel, client area, email, FTP, database and all WordPress admins. Use new strong, unique passwords.
- Scan for malware using the Virus Scanner in the panel at my.dirhamaday.ae; our servers also run continuous scanning.
- Restore a clean backup from DirhamVault from before the infection, if available.
- Close the entry point: update WordPress core, plugins and themes; remove unknown admin users and unfamiliar files; delete unused plugins.
- Re-secure: enable two-factor authentication and review who has access.
Do not just restore and move on; if you don't fix the original weakness (often an outdated plugin or a weak password), the site can be reinfected.
